What is rosm?

rosm 0.3.0 silently deprecates its entire API and rebuilds on wk and curl

rosm downloads and stitches raster map tiles from OpenStreetMap and similar sources for use in R. After six years without a release, 0.3.0 deprecated the whole previous API, dropped the rgdal dependency, and introduced a replacement built on wk geometry and curl's multi-download interface. The follow-up 0.3.1 is documentation and CI work, plus test skips for Bing and Stamen URLs that no longer resolve.

What is seriation?

seriation stopped shipping algorithms and started shipping a way to pick between them.

seriation finds meaningful orderings for matrices, distance objects and dendrograms, and carries a large registry of methods from classic combinatorial criteria to t-SNE and UMAP embeddings. The 1.5.0 release added a layer above that registry — seriate_best(), seriate_rep() and seriate_improve() — which run randomized methods repeatedly, in parallel, and keep the best result. Recent work is definitional and numeric rather than additive: 1.5.8 corrects the linear seriation criterion to match Hubert and Schultz's original 1976 definition.

◆ Where it's heading

The package is being brought back from dormancy on modern foundations rather than extended. rgdal's retirement forced the issue, and the maintainer used it to replace the download path with concurrent curl requests and to hand geometry handling to wk. What follows is consolidation: dead built-in tile sources are being tested around rather than replaced, which leaves the source registry as the obvious unfinished edge.

◆ Prediction

The dead Bing and Stamen endpoints are currently skipped rather than fixed, so the next release most likely prunes or re-points the built-in tile source list and continues retiring the silently deprecated functions.

◆ Where it's heading

The package has shifted from breadth to judgment. Through 1.3.x the additions were new methods; from 1.5.0 the registry started carrying metadata about the methods — whether they are randomized, what criterion they optimize — so the package could choose and evaluate on the user's behalf. The 1.5.6 replacement of FORTRAN with C for BEA and ME points the same way, reducing the legacy surface underneath that machinery.

◆ Prediction

Further criterion audits are the likeliest next move, since 1.5.8 shows a published definition being reconciled against the implementation and the registry now records what each method optimizes. Expect corrections rather than new seriation algorithms.
